Output d83c9bc5f69a0161bd4ece45ae91f0233e9d4e835dc5162a55a24262ccf0a230:0

value
20519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e1c782a98734166630aed01a0ab34487bcd06e OP_EQUAL
address
3BFafvAk3RbNfgLYANqeyRnB2p1pBTWKsh
transaction
d83c9bc5f69a0161bd4ece45ae91f0233e9d4e835dc5162a55a24262ccf0a230
confirmations
231642
spent
true